GTA 6 might make weapon choices matter more than ever.

Based on details seen in official trailers, leaked gameplay footage, and Rockstar's previous push toward realism in Red Dead Redemption 2, many fans believe players may no longer be able to instantly pull out every weapon they own at any time.

Instead, weapons could be limited to what Jason or Lucia are physically carrying on their body, with additional gear stored in vehicles, safehouses, or weapon stashes. That would mean preparing before a mission becomes just as important as the mission itself.

Picture arriving at a robbery with only a pistol and shotgun, then realizing your rifle is still locked in the trunk of your car across town. A simple weapon choice could completely change how an encounter plays out.

Nothing has been officially confirmed by Rockstar, but many players see it as a natural evolution of the weapon-carry system introduced in Red Dead Redemption 2.

🖥️ Millions of PC players may have to wait another year or more for GTA 6.

🎮 Despite PC gaming becoming one of the industry's biggest platforms, Rockstar is once again launching Grand Theft Auto VI on consoles first, leaving many PC players eager for news on when they'll finally get their hands on the game.

📢 Take-Two CEO Strauss Zelnick recently explained that Rockstar prioritizes serving its core audience at launch, continuing a strategy the company has followed for years.

⏳ While GTA 6 arrives on P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X|S on November 19, 2026, Rockstar has not announced a PC version or release window. The company has historically launched major titles on consoles first before bringing them to PC at a later date.

📅 For comparison, GTA V launched on consoles in 2013 and didn't reach PC until 2015, while Red Dead Redemption 2 arrived on PC roughly a year after its console debut. Based on that track record, industry analysts and fans widely expect GTA 6 to reach PC sometime in 2027, though Rockstar and Take-Two have yet to confirm any plans.
